Irritable Bowel Syndrome (IBS)
IBS is a motility disorder of the small and large intestine that can cause:
abdominal pain
diarrhea or constipation
bloating
flatulence
nausea
headache
depression
tiredness and more.
Typically, IBS gets worse with increased stress, certain foods/ medicine or hormones.
